Any person who by himself or with others wilfully or
corruptly violates any of the provisions of this section
shall be guilty of a misdemeanor and shall, upon convic-
tion thereof, be punished by a fine of not more than one
hundred dollars ($100. 00), or by imprisonment for a term
not exceeding ninety days, or both by such fine and im-
prisonment. Any person who is convicted under this sec-
tion shall for a period of five years be ineligible for ap-
pointment or employment in a position in the city service,
and shall, if he be an officer or employee of the city, imme-
diately forfeit the office or position he holds.

ARTICLE X

DEPARTMENT OF PUBLIC WORKS
CITY ENGINEER

139. There shall be a Department of Public Works
headed by the city engineer. The city engineer shall be
appointed by the mayor with the advice and consent of
the board of aldermen, and shall serve at the pleasure of
the mayor. He shall be a registered professional engi-
neer in the State of Maryland. His compensation shall be
determined by the board of aldermen. For convenience of
administration, the mayor and the city engineer, with the
consent of the board of aldermen, may divide the Depart-
ment of Public Works into bureaus, such as a bureau of
engineering, a bureau of streets, a bureau of water supply,
a bureau of sanitation, a bureau of electric lights, a bu-
reau of parks and public property, and other similar
bureaus.
